Beginning Monday, Palo Pinto General Hospital is adding back to its repertoire the Santo Clinic, which brings the hospital’s rural health clinic total back to four.
For the past three years the clinic has been under the umbrella of Weatherford Regional Medical Center. PPGH opened the clinic in 2003 and operated it until August 2008.
In addition to addressing Santo Clinic at Tuesday’s meeting hospital trustees heard of the growing needs of the neighboring Gordon Clinic, also a part of the PPGH rural health clinic system.
The lease on the building is up and CEO Harris Brooks said they face some options, such as, “renewing the lease, purchasing the building outright or building our own stand-alone from the ground up.”
